Overview (Text Only): The Retail Planner will play an important role in ensuring a successful integration of the merchant/product groups within Foot Locker Asia Pacific. The Retail Planner will also establish and deliver product lifecycle strategies to efficiently manage all inventories. Responsibilities:
**Vision & Delivery**
- Deliver efficiencies across the Asia Pacific planning team, aligning on systems, processes, and planning tasks.
- Make decisions to guide the team in achieving the Division’s annual sales, (gross margin) profit and stock turn targets.
- Execute all financial & product reporting required (daily, weekly, monthly, quarterly) and aim for constant improvements for Foot Locker Asia Pacific
- Partner with the Buying, Marketing and Allocation departments to deliver on buying targets for key categories/stories and maximize the Omni sales potential
- Partner with the respective buying & allocation team members to make the right purchasing decisions to exceed the company goals
- Work with the Director Planning to constantly review and refine processes/systems to enhance further efficiencies
- Actively participate all internal communication touch points, including but not exclusive to:
- Weekly Go To Market Omni meeting
- Monthly OTR reviews
- All Post Season Review sessions
- All Buy Sign Off meetings
- CX Summits & Kick Off Meeting.
- Play a lead role in managing the inventory lifecycle by working alongside Pricing and Space Planning teams.
- Work closely with all vendor partners to effectively manage inventory from order flow, intake, sell through reporting and analysis, and collaborating on necessary clearance actions (partnered markdown credits, RTVs)
